pullulate

 
Verb pullulate has 5 senses
  1. teem, pullulate, swarm - be teeming, be abuzz; "The garden was swarming with bees"; "The plaza is teeming with undercover policemen"; "her mind pullulated with worries"
    --1 is one way to hum, buzz, seethe

  2. pour, swarm, stream, teem, pullulate - move in large numbers; "people were pouring out of the theater"; "beggars pullulated in the plaza"
    --2 is one way to crowd, crowd together

  3. shoot, spud, germinate, pullulate, bourgeon, burgeon forth, sprout - produce buds, branches, or germinate; "the potatoes sprouted"
    --3 is one way to grow
    Derived form: noun pullulation1

  4. pullulate - become abundant; increase rapidly
    --4 is one way to
    increase
    Derived form: noun pullulation2

  5. pullulate - breed freely and abundantly
    --5 is one way to
    breed, multiply
